Grounds for election
James Conolly’s interests lie at the intersection of archaeology and geography, and he integrates approaches from both disciplines in his research and teaching. He was Lecturer in Archaeology at UCL’s Institute of Archaeology (1999-2004) and his initial work focused on economic organization in European Neolithic and BA societies, along with the application of geospatial methods of analysis in settlement pattern studies. In 2004 he moved to Trent University (Canada) as Canada Research Chair in Archaeology, and was promoted to Full Professor in 2014. He now conducts research mainly in the territories of the Michi Saagig Anishinaabeg on the archaeology of complex hunter-gatherer and early agricultural communities. He directs field research and community-based training programs in cooperation with local Indigenous nations. He is an editor for World Archaeology, director of the Ontario Archaeological Soc, member of the Canadian Archaeological Association & the Ontario Marine Heritage Soc.
